Embodiment

[0035] The control method of the present invention includes the following steps.

[0036] Let the current moment be T 0 , predict time T P =30 points, the number of days for historical statistics is 3 days, and the forecast time and number of days for statistics can be adjusted as needed.

[0037] 3 days before calculation T 0 to T 0 +T P The total average value of all frequency deviations at the moment is used as the predicted value of frequency deviation at the current point, Δf P .

[0038] Calculate the CPS correction component of the AGC total power, and use the following formula to calculate the frequency deviation correction component.

[0039] P CPS = - G × sign(Δf P )

Abstract

The invention relates to a control method of AGC facing a control performance standard (CPS) and a control system thereof. Through setting structures of a data acquisition and pretreatment portion, an AGC total power calculating portion, an AGC total power distribution portion, a parameter set interface, an AGC state monitoring portion and the like, based on a frequency difference expectation, AGC regulating variable can be determined and an integral control link is canceled so that AGC set adjustment times can be effectively reduced. Set wear can be greatly reduced and energy consumption can be effective reduced too. The method and the system are beneficial to realize energy saving and emission reduction for power grid.

Description

technical field [0001] The present invention relates to an electric power control system, in particular to a control method and control system for automatic power generation control oriented to a control performance evaluation standard (CPS-control performance standard). Background technique [0002] According to the principle of "unified dispatching and hierarchical management", the dispatching at all levels should strictly implement the plan of sending, sending and receiving power, and strictly control and assess the deviation between the power of the tie line and the system frequency.
